My build quickly started in February of 2015 with the front leveling kit as I can't stand how the front is in a nose dive look on all runners. I didn't do anything to the rear and found through research that the best choice was a steel 2.5" spacer which just mounts to the top of the shock/spring assembly. I don't suggest the nylon or aluminum spacers as I've heard they crack. Here's my before and after. Note: my driveway slants to the rear so the nose isn't as high as it appears. It's perfectly level to the ground as measured frame to ground.
Next was changing the customizable features for the side and rear power windows. You can go to a dealer and ask them to change them to allow you to roll the side windows down via the remote and roll them up with the key in the driver door handle. The rear can be changed to allow you to roll it up and down with the key in the back door. If you have a sunroof you can do that via the remote too. Up next was my desire to add LED running lights to the front like you see on almost every car out there now. I decided to do individual LED's in the honeycomb of the fog light bezels. You can see my first version but I quickly realized they weren't big or bright enough so search for bigger and brighter LED's and went from a 5mm/20k mcd to 10mm/190k mcd. Each LED had a resistor and they are wired through a relay that is triggered on when I turn the ignition on. I wanted them on all the time and didn't want to switch them on. I quickly then disconnected my stock boring DRL's so I can run my parking lights without the DRL's. Having full access to the factory wiring diagrams was a blessing here. Now since you can play video through the aux jack and on the factory head unit, adding a DVD player and streaming capability would turn out to be my biggest mod to date. This would become tough due to HDCP encryption companies have in place on DVD players and through streaming making it difficult to pass hdmi into composite video to hook up to the factory system. I first wired direct to the back of the aux jack circuit board my rca (yellow, white, red) and tested my directv box in my garage to see if I can get video. Come to find Toyota has the red and yellow switched through the mini jack so I corrected that during the soldering onto the circuit board. I got video and I was stoked! Now to find a spot for a DVD player and to find one that fit the best. First thought was to find a small one and stick it under a seat but that wasn't good enough and I wanted to build it in somewhere. Since I don't have 4 wheel drive, that spot in the console sounded great to me. Now to find the right player. For price and the fact that I wanted streaming capability I decided to go with a home unit and found a small Toshiba bluray player and quickly took it apart to find it would fit. I proceeded to make a slot out of the side of my console and then though I needed to relocate the IR so I can use the remote. I found that I could extend the IR and cleverly hide it behind the smoked plexi for the passenger airbag light. Once I got it all hooked up I realized I didn't like the streaming capabilities and opted to change it up a bit and just scrap that DVD player and get a simpler one (LG) and add the Lightning to hdmi Apple adapter for streaming as then I can stream Directv, Netflix, Hulu, Amazon, etc. the LG player nearly has the same tray and guts as the Toshiba so it worked out perfect and the tray front is the same so my slot didn't change. I located my hdmi adapter in the tray where the 4-wheel drive is so all I do is connect my phone which sits conveniently in the tray. Now I needed to bring power up front from the inverter. I tapped into the inverter in the back and ran power to the front under the radio. I had to power 3 things but first, back to the HDCP issue so I can stream. After a lot of reading on blogs, I found I could use an hdmi splitter to drop that encryption. So being I went with a simple DVD player, that is connected via composite video to the back of the aux jack, and my lightning to hdmi adapter is connected through the hdmi splitter then through an hdmi to composite converter then into the back of the aux jack. Now the next tough part was to make it so I could play video while driving since the truck wants you to not be moving over roughly 5 miles per hour and have the parking brake on. So through the factory wiring diagrams I figured out how to kill those signals without affecting the car or having it throw codes. The parking brake was easy as I simply had to disconnect the signal wire from the ecu and ground it from the back of the head unit. The speed sensor was a bit trickier but with the use of a relay I was able to basically create a kill switch which activates when I flip on the inverter. Walla! Killing the speed sensor does kill the ability to use navi while driving but if I'm watching a movie I can't be watching navi so moot point to me. What happens is you don't seems to move on the navi when the speed sensors are cut. Once I turn off the inverter the navi works just fine.
